Call the Midwife Season 13 Episode 1 Airs March 18 2024 on PBS

This Monday at 7:00 PM on PBS, fans of “Call the Midwife” are in for a compelling start to Season 13 with Episode 1. The episode sets the stage for a new chapter as Nonnatus House welcomes a new group of pupil midwives. Dr. Turner takes charge, overseeing the delivery of a baby whose mother is coping with cerebral palsy, adding a layer of complexity and compassion to the storyline.

As the clock approaches 7:00 PM, viewers can expect an emotionally charged narrative that addresses both the challenges and joys of midwifery. Additionally, the “Raise the Roof Campaign” introduces a significant subplot, revealing the internal struggles and divisions among the nurses as they advocate for better pay and working conditions.

Call the Midwife Cast – Season 13 Episode 1

Main Cast
Jenny Agutter as Sister Julienne
Annabelle Apsion as Violet Buckle
Linda Bassett as Nurse Phyllis Crane
Leonie Elliott as Nurse Lucille Anderson
Helen George as Nurse Beatrix `Trixie' Franklin
Laura Main as Nurse Shelagh Turner (formerly Sister Bernadette)
Stephen McGann as Dr Patrick Turner
Judy Parfitt as Sister Monica Joan
Cliff Parisi as Fred Buckle
Vanessa Redgrave as Voice of Jennifer Worth
Fenella Woolgar as Sister Hilda
Ella Bruccoleri as Sister Frances
Georgie Glen as Miss Higgins
Daniel Laurie as Reggie Jackson
Zephryn Taitte as Cyril Robinson
Megan Cusack as Nurse Nancy Corrigan
Lydia Larson as Lilian Reynolds
Rebecca Gethings as Sister Veronica
Olly Rix as Matthew Aylward
